Crews battle massive house fire in Detroit’s Palmer Woods neighborhood
DETROIT – Crews battled a massive house fire in the Palmer Woods Historic District early Wednesday morning.
The home near 7 Mile and Woodward in Detroit can be seen with flames shooting out of the roof in the main house on Oct. 9.
Local 4 learned the homeowners were living in the guest house while fixing up the main home—they are okay.
(WDIV) According to Historic Detroit , the Mirton Briggs House was built in the 1920s as a spec house by Clarence E Day. The first owner was Mirton L. Briggs, Vice President of the Briggs Manufacturing Co., manufacturer of automobile bodies. It was last sold in June 2023 for $950,000.
At this time, there is no word on what caused the fire.
